Output 2e626b3ff95aed9c2865d06cb73b9612a9d7db8b84fe7631183bcc20c6e2385a:0

value
73015
script pubkey
OP_0 OP_PUSHBYTES_20 e0630d7e86bee945f1b4243e2c02ce14b2fe7309
address
bc1qup3s6l5xhm55tud5yslzcqkwzje0uucftxp8qv
transaction
2e626b3ff95aed9c2865d06cb73b9612a9d7db8b84fe7631183bcc20c6e2385a
spent
true